Your reading brought us the 7 of Wands, the 8 of Wands and the Emperor. With two out of three cards being wands, this relationship feels like a lot of effort is required. Wands symbolize work, decisions and enterprise. You have not chosen an easy path for yourself.
The 7 of Wands shows a person toiling away with an expression of haste. Notice his right shoe is different than his left, and his right foot is dangerously near a cliff. You are obviously in a very insecure situation and trying to get a foothold where you can feel more grounded and safe. This battle for security appears risky and uncertain.
The 8 of Wands is about the build up of momentum that can lead to success. It is also a card of travel, as it symbolizes progress being made. It shows a swiftness of movement and action being taken. Whatever happens is going to happen quickly, this is not going to be a long, drawn-out affair.
The Emperor symbolizes a person enjoying their seat of power. He likes the situation the way it is, especially since he knows where everyone stands. He is careful not to upset anyone.
